Dora hasn't had much luck against Gateway Christian recently, but that could start to change on Monday. The Coyotes will be playing in front of their home fans against the Warriors at 6:00 p.m. Expect the scorekeeper to be kept busy: if their previous games are any indication, these teams will really light up the scoreboard.
Gateway Christian will be up against a hot Dora team: the squad just extended their winning streak to three. The Coyotes came out on top against Floyd by a score of 14-11 on Friday.
Meanwhile, winning is always nice, but doing so behind a season-high score is even better (just ask Gateway Christian). They blew past Melrose 26-1 on Friday. The result was nothing new for the Warriors, who have now won seven matches by eight runs or more so far this season.
Gateway Christian is on a roll lately: they've won five of their last six contests. That's provided a nice bump to their 8-4 record this season. Those victories came thanks in part to their hitting performance across that stretch, as they averaged 15.7 runs over those games. As for Dora, their win was their third straight at home, which pushed their record up to 4-9.
